Sourcing guidance for Worm Gearbox

How to choose the right Worm Gearbox for industrial applications?

Selecting a worm gearbox requires balancing torque requirements, reduction ratios, and thermal efficiency. You must first determine the Service Factor based on the daily operating hours and load nature (uniform vs. heavy shock). For high-precision tasks, prioritize low-backlash models to ensure positional accuracy. Always verify the housing material; die-cast aluminum is suitable for lightweight applications, while cast iron (HT200/250) is essential for heavy-duty industrial environments to dampen vibration.

What are the key technical specifications and compliance standards for Worm Gearboxes?

Ensure the gearbox complies with ISO 9001:2015 for quality management and CE marking for European market access. Key specs include the Center Distance, which defines the size and load capacity, and the Input/Output Shaft diameters. For the worm wheel, look for Tin Bronze (CuSn12) rather than cheaper aluminum bronze to ensure superior wear resistance and a longer lifespan. Efficiency is also critical; remember that higher ratios (e.g., 100:1) have lower mechanical efficiency compared to lower ratios (e.g., 10:1).

What are the common usage scenarios and maintenance requirements?

Worm gearboxes are ideal for conveyor systems, packaging machinery, and elevators due to their self-locking capability, which prevents back-driving. Maintenance is vital: the first oil change should occur after 500 hours of operation, followed by intervals of 3,000-5,000 hours. Use synthetic lubricants (PAG or PAO) for high-temperature environments to prevent oil oxidation and seal failure.

Cross-Border Procurement Considerations for Worm Gearboxes

What are the primary risks when sourcing gearboxes internationally?

The biggest risks are material substitution (using inferior bronze alloys) and shipping damage. To mitigate this, request a Material Test Report (MTR) for the worm gear and ensure the supplier uses fumigated wooden crates with internal moisture barriers to prevent rust during sea freight. How should I negotiate with suppliers for bulk orders?

Focus on the Total Cost of Ownership (TCO) rather than just the unit price. Negotiate for spare parts kits (seals and bearings) to be included in the bulk price. For orders exceeding 500 units, aim for a 15-25% discount and request customized nameplates or OEM branding at no extra cost. Always clarify the Incoterms (typically FOB or CIF) to avoid hidden logistics fees.

What shipping methods are recommended for heavy mechanical components?

Due to the high weight-to-volume ratio, Sea Freight (LCL or FCL) is the most economical method. For urgent prototypes, Air Freight is possible but expensive. Ensure the supplier provides a detailed packing list and HS Code (typically 8483.40) to facilitate smooth customs clearance and accurate duty calculation in the destination country.
